Orsted shares jump 12% after US judge lifts Trump ban on Revolution Wind project

Orsted shares surged after a U.S. federal judge allowed its 80% complete Revolution Wind project to resume, reversing a previous administration's work-stop order. This ruling is a significant win for the Danish offshore wind developer, which was losing $2 million daily and facing potential credit rating pressure amid broader financial headwinds. The resumption alleviates immediate financial strain and supports the company's liquidity strategy, following a recent $9.4 billion rights issue aimed at bolstering its financial position.

Analysis

Orsted has secured a significant operational and legal victory following a U.S. federal judge's ruling to allow the resumption of its Revolution Wind project. This decision reverses a work-stop order that was costing the company $2 million per day and removes the immediate threat of over $1 billion in breakaway costs for the nearly-completed project, in which Orsted and its partner have already invested approximately $5 billion. The market has reacted strongly, with shares rising as much as 12%, reflecting the de-risking of a key asset. This development provides critical relief as the company was already navigating substantial financial headwinds from inflation, rising interest rates, and supply chain disruptions. The project's continuation validates the company's recent capital strategy, including a $9.4 billion rights issue designed to create a 145 billion DKK ($22.9 billion) liquidity reserve, which the CFO stated is sufficient to complete existing projects. While the ruling alleviates a major source of uncertainty and cash drain, it does not eliminate the underlying fundamental pressures affecting the offshore wind sector.
